376org/elasticsearch/index/analysis/NGramTokenizerFactory9org/elasticsearch/index/analysis/AbstractTokenizerFactoryNGramTokenizerFactory.java8org/elasticsearch/index/analysis/NGramTokenizerFactory$14org/elasticsearch/index/analysis/CharMatcher$Builder,org/elasticsearch/index/analysis/CharMatcher Builder5org/elasticsearch/common/collect/ImmutableMap$Builder -org/elasticsearch/common/collect/ImmutableMap2org/elasticsearch/index/analysis/CharMatcher$BasicBasic>org/elasticsearch/index/analysis/CharMatcher$ByUnicodeCategoryByUnicodeCategoryminGramImaxGrammatcher.Lorg/elasticsearch/index/analysis/CharMatcher; esVersionLorg/elasticsearch/Version;MATCHERSLjava/util/Map;QLjava/util/Map;parseTokenCharsC([Ljava/lang/String;)Lorg/elasticsearch/index/analysis/CharMatcher;()V #$ %[Ljava/lang/String;'java/util/Locale)ROOTLjava/util/Locale; +, *-java/lang/String/ toLowerCase&(Ljava/util/Locale;)Ljava/lang/String; 12 03trim()Ljava/lang/String; 56 07  9 java/util/Map;get&(Ljava/lang/Object;)Ljava/lang/Object; => <?7org/elasticsearch/ElasticsearchIllegalArgumentExceptionAjava/lang/StringBuilderC D%Unknown token type: 'Fappend-(Ljava/lang/String;)Ljava/lang/StringBuilder; HI DJ', must be one of LkeySet()Ljava/util/Set; NO <P-(Ljava/lang/Object;)Ljava/lang/StringBuilder; HR DStoString U6 DV(Ljava/lang/String;)V #X BYorf(Lorg/elasticsearch/index/analysis/CharMatcher;)Lorg/elasticsearch/index/analysis/CharMatcher$Builder; [\ ]build0()Lorg/elasticsearch/index/analysis/CharMatcher; _` acharacterClassLjava/lang/String;arr$len$i$characterClassesbuilder6Lorg/elasticsearch/index/analysis/CharMatcher$Builder;(Lorg/elasticsearch/index/Index;Lorg/elasticsearch/common/settings/Settings;Ljava/lang/String;Lorg/elasticsearch/common/settings/Settings;)V(Lorg/elasticsearch/common/inject/Inject;0Lorg/elasticsearch/index/settings/IndexSettings;9Lorg/elasticsearch/common/inject/assistedinject/Assisted; #k omin_gramqjava/lang/IntegersvalueOf(I)Ljava/lang/Integer; uv tw*org/elasticsearch/common/settings/SettingsygetAsInt:(Ljava/lang/String;Ljava/lang/Integer;)Ljava/lang/Integer; {| z}intValue()I  t  max_gram   token_chars getAsArray'(Ljava/lang/String;)[Ljava/lang/String; z !"   org/elasticsearch/Version indexCreatedI(Lorg/elasticsearch/common/settings/Settings;)Lorg/elasticsearch/Version;  this8Lorg/elasticsearch/index/analysis/NGramTokenizerFactory;indexLorg/elasticsearch/index/Index; indexSettings,Lorg/elasticsearch/common/settings/Settings;namesettingscreate8(Ljava/io/Reader;)Lorg/apache/lucene/analysis/Tokenizer;version Lorg/apache/lucene/util/Version; org/apache/lucene/util/Version LUCENE_43  onOrAfter#(Lorg/apache/lucene/util/Version;)Z V_0_90_2  (Lorg/elasticsearch/Version;)Z  LUCENE_44 /org/apache/lucene/analysis/ngram/NGramTokenizer5(Lorg/apache/lucene/util/Version;Ljava/io/Reader;II)V # m(Lorg/elasticsearch/index/analysis/NGramTokenizerFactory;Lorg/apache/lucene/util/Version;Ljava/io/Reader;II)V # 7org/apache/lucene/analysis/ngram/Lucene43NGramTokenizer(Ljava/io/Reader;II)V # readerLjava/io/Reader; access$000h(Lorg/elasticsearch/index/analysis/NGramTokenizerFactory;)Lorg/elasticsearch/index/analysis/CharMatcher;x0java/lang/Exception9()Lorg/elasticsearch/common/collect/ImmutableMap$Builder; i letterLETTER4Lorg/elasticsearch/index/analysis/CharMatcher$Basic; put](Ljava/lang/Object;Ljava/lang/Object;)Lorg/elasticsearch/common/collect/ImmutableMap$Builder; digitDIGIT  whitespace WHITESPACE  punctuation PUNCTUATION symbolSYMBOL java/lang/Characterjava/lang/Class getFields()[Ljava/lang/reflect/Field; [Ljava/lang/reflect/Field;java/lang/reflect/FieldgetName 6 DIRECTIONALITY startsWith(Ljava/lang/String;)Z  0 getModifiers  java/lang/reflect/Modifier isPublic(I)Z     isStatic   getType()Ljava/lang/Class;  java/lang/ByteTYPELjava/lang/Class;  getByte(Ljava/lang/Object;)B  of1(B)Lorg/elasticsearch/index/analysis/CharMatcher;  ! "1()Lorg/elasticsearch/common/collect/ImmutableMap; _$ %eLjava/lang/Exception;fieldLjava/lang/reflect/Field;yLorg/elasticsearch/common/collect/ImmutableMap$Builder;7Lorg/elasticsearch/common/collect/ImmutableMap$Builder; SignatureCodeLocalVariableTableLineNumberTable StackMapTableRuntimeVisibleAnnotations"RuntimeVisibleParameterAnnotationsLocalVariableTypeTable SourceFile InnerClasses!- !".F** Y&L*M,>6c,2:.48::@ :/BYDYEGKKMK:QTWZ+^W+b/HC8'Tcdle'iffgh'sij0. N O QR'S4TCUHVtX{RZ1, ( (X0 ( #k.J*+,-p*rx~*x~**,/4JJJJdJ0_ `a1bAcId2l3mnn.l*Q*D* *M*Y,+**Y*,+**°Y+**ǰ/ /,ll0in/o6pHr[z1*C./*/ 0,$.K*ԲضW*޲W*W*W*WL+=>^+2:E:/$*.4#W:*&:z/>'(KP)*<ee?bfA`gi,4 i+0>6789":,;6=K>zCGDF=JK1,AT56*   @